The Question is: AlphaStation running OpenVms7.1 and DecWindows v1.2-4. From pc running exceed v6.1 trying to get decw$terminal to display doesn't work because decw$terminal won't go to a tcp/ip address with a non-zero display/screen! If the pc running the exceed has it's display/screen set to 0 the command works, else it doesn't go anywhere. command is @sys$system:pcx$server 4,0,0,tcpip,@a decw$terminal the standard...the @a puts in the pc's address, an @d would put in the address with the display/screen number but like I said if it's not zero it won't work in VMS. I do not have this restriction with UNIX (AIX nor HP-UX) Any ideas? The Answer is : Please contact the Compaq Customer Support Center as this involves some software in addition to the more common OpenVMS and DECwindows -- the PCX$SERVER module initially appears to be the source of the limitation reported here. As an experiment, try the SET DISPLAY command, specifying the IP transport and IP address, as well as the screen number.
